Verizon had me dial *920, the rep said that they had seen cases where "call forward on busy" (which *920 turns off) would prevent MMS from going through, and after I turned it off I was able to send a pic to myself and got it immediately, but the next morning I was back to not being able to send/receive MMS via Textra. Open Textra, and go to settings > Customize Notifications > Notification Sound Select the sound you want, and hit OK at the bottom of the screen.
